Three female prison officers has been sent on leave while authorities investigate allegations of inappropriate conduct involving a male inmate at His Majesty’s Prison.
Prison Superintendent Colonel Trevor Pennyfeather confirmed that the matter has been referred to the prison’s disciplinary committee and is expected to be heard next week.
Pennyfeather declined to disclose the precise nature of the alleged conduct, stressing that the disciplinary process is still underway.
According to the superintendent, the alleged conduct involved both the officer’s behaviour and communications with the inmate.
He said prison authorities are handling the matter in accordance with the law and the regulations governing the institution.
“The conduct that is expected of an officer was not being realised,” Pennyfeather said. “If an officer behaves in a manner that is in total disregard of the laws and regulations governing their employment, disciplinary measures must be taken.”
The superintendent said the alleged activity occurred over several weeks, and possibly months, before prison authorities uncovered it.
He declined to say how prison management learned of the matter.
Pennyfeather stressed that any inappropriate relationship or interaction between an officer and an inmate represents more than a breach of professional standards, as it can create serious security concerns within the penal institution.
“It becomes a security concern, and it erodes the whole fabric of the security and safety of the prison,” he said.
The female officer remains off duty pending the outcome of the disciplinary proceedings.
No finding of wrongdoing has yet been made, and the officer will have an opportunity to respond to the allegations before the disciplinary committee.
